    Pyridine is a basic heterocyclic organic compound with the chemical formula C 5 H 5 N. It is structurally related to benzene, with one methine group (=CH−) replaced by a nitrogen atom (=N−). It is a highly flammable, weakly alkaline, water-miscible liquid with a distinctive, unpleasant fish

    Glycin, or N-(4-hydroxyphenyl)glycine, is N-substituted p-aminophenol. It is a photographic developing agent used in classic black-and-white developer solutions. [2] It is not identical to, but derived from glycine, the proteinogenic amino acid. It is typically characterized as thin plates of white or silvery powder, although aged samples ...
